I found some helpful foods are airfried potatoes (chopped and mixed with olive oil, salt, pepper, paprika. Super low calories and it literally is the same as fast food fries to me). Protein pancakes with some kind of low calorie/sugar free syrup -- the recipe is a carton of egg whites, 8 white slices of bread, vanilla extract, cinnamon all blended together. These are delicious as fuck, I did the calculations and the entire batter came out to 1020 calories for 5 cups. 1 cup is a well sized pancake which is good to add some greek yogurt or fruits to, 2 cups is literally GINORMOUS.
